Output ead0c6861d47d088c5a4e98d28a362da33436a938b94b0dd9dabefde34adf7d9:26

value
258560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9518f894f5453b5b75b29e7928d1f83f0748e691 OP_EQUAL
address
3FHNX9HF14p3aASnAT2y8yW8iBqfn8264A
transaction
ead0c6861d47d088c5a4e98d28a362da33436a938b94b0dd9dabefde34adf7d9
spent
true